A handcrafted German brush combining 100% first-cut boar bristles with nylon pins to gently detangle, smooth and improve hair texture for normal to thick hair.
SHASH Since 1869 brings a traditional, hand-finished brush made in Germany that blends natural boar bristles with nylon pins for balanced detangling and smoothing. The medium-size design is aimed at normal to thick hair types and created to minimize pulling, reduce visible frizz and distribute natural oils from roots to ends.
How does this brush detangle without tugging?
The mixed bristle construction uses firm nylon pins to separate knots while the first-cut boar bristles glide through strands to reduce friction. That dual-action lets you remove tangles gradually instead of yanking, which helps prevent breakage and split ends.
- Nylon pins lift and separate individual strands for easier knot removal.
- Boar bristles smooth the hair shaft and reduce static.
- Medium paddle spreads pressure evenly to avoid concentrated pulling.
- Work from ends to roots to further minimize tugging.
Will this brush improve my hair’s feel and shine?
Boar bristles are effective at redistributing the natural scalp oils along the hair shaft, which helps sections that tend to look dry regain a smoother appearance. Regular brushing with this tool can make hair feel softer and appear more uniform in texture, without relying on additional styling products.
- Natural bristles carry sebum toward the ends for improved sheen.
- Gentle smoothing reduces rough cuticle edges that catch light poorly.
- Use on dry hair to promote natural oil distribution for added gloss.
Can I use the brush on damp hair or thick hair types?
It’s suitable for damp or dry normal to thick hair when used carefully. For wet hair, follow gentle technique and consider working in sections to prevent overstressing strands; for thicker hair, sectioning helps the brush work more efficiently and reduces repeated passes.
- On damp hair: brush gently from ends upward to reduce strain.
- On thick hair: divide into sections to detangle methodically.
- Not intended for heavy wet-styling—avoid aggressive brushing when soaking wet.
How should I care for this handmade brush to keep it working well?
Routine maintenance extends the brush’s life and keeps it hygienic. Remove hair after each use and wash the head periodically with warm, soapy water; let it dry bristle-side down to protect the wooden parts and prevent mildew.
- Clean every 1–2 weeks or sooner with warm water and mild soap.
- Inspect bristles for bending or wear; replace when bristles degrade.
- Store dry and avoid prolonged heat exposure to preserve the handle.
